Airport world leaders reiterate the significant economic impact of airports on the local and world economies as the ACI Asia Pacific Regional Event comes to an end and the Hamad International Airport hands over the hosting duties to Narita Airport, Tokyo

 

DOHA, Qatar – The 12th Airport Council International (ACI) Asia Pacific Regional Assembly, Conference and Exhibition hosted by Hamad International Airport (HIA) in Doha, under the patronage of H.E Mr. Jassim Seif Ahmed Al Sulaiti, the Minister of Transport and Communications of the State of Qatar, concluded with an official closing ceremony at the St. Regis hotel.

The ACI event, which takes place internationally on an annual basis, was attended by world industry leaders WHO, over the 3 day conference, addressed major issues and exchanged ideas and best practices that can further advance the aviation industry. Among the key themes discussed were the role of airports as corporate responsible citizens within their societies, the latest technological innovations and their positive impact on passenger experience, airport security and the expansion of the scope of the non-aeronautical activities especially when developing airport cities. Airport CEOs expressed their optimism about the traffic growth for 2017 and airports delivering strong results, with a direct positive economic and social impact on the local and world economies.

Several prestigious aviation award ceremonies took place during the event, including the Green Airports Recognition and ACI’s Airport Carbon Accreditation Awards.

The event concluded on the 12 th of April 2017 with a handover ceremony during which HIA’s representative, Mr. Abdul-Aziz Al Mass, Vice President of Commercial and Marketing officially handed over the hosting responsibilities to Mr. Kenichi Fukaya, Senior Executive Advisor of Narita International Airport, which will be the host airport of the 13 th ACI Asia Pacific Regional Assembly in Tokyo, Japan.

As part of the host’s closing remarks, Mr. Abdul-Aziz Al Mass, Vice President of Commercial and Marketing of Hamad International Airport said: “It has been an honour to host the 12th ACI Asia Pacific Regional Assembly, Conference and Exhibition in the State of Qatar. Together with ACI Asia Pacific, we’ve enjoyed providing our guests with a platform to come together and make a difference to the future of aviation. We hope you got a taste of Qatar’s warm hospitality and culture during your stay in our country and we look forward to welcoming you back very soon."
